Risks & Rewards: A Realistic Look at Day Trading
Day trading can seem incredibly attractive to novices , fueled by stories of quick earnings. Still, it’s crucial to appreciate that this activity isn’t a guaranteed path to wealth . The likely payoffs – the opportunity to generate significant revenue in a brief timeframe – are counteracted by considerable risks. In particular , day speculators face the peril of more info losing their starting capital due to market instability, reactive decision-making , and the requirement for persistent surveillance and discipline . Thus , a pragmatic assessment demands a complete consideration of both the upside and the drawbacks.
Day Trading Tools & Tech: Level Up Your System
To excel in the dynamic world of day trading, having the right tools and equipment is truly crucial. It's no longer sufficient to simply rely on conventional charting software. Traders now need a sophisticated arsenal to assess market movements and manage trades with precision . This includes streaming market information , powerful graphing platforms designed of complex technical indicators, and robust execution systems to minimize slippage and increase profits. Consider exploring:
- Low-latency data providers
- Detailed graphing programs
- Automated execution systems
- Depth of Market data
- Paper exchange systems for honing your skills
Investing in the ideal technology can considerably enhance your potential of generating consistent profits .
